Overview of Progressive Metal musician kadinja

Kadinja is a progressive metal band from Paris, France, and they have been creating waves in the music scene with their own sound and approach. They are renowned for their complex instrumental compositions, thunderous riffs, and strong voices. The band distinguishes themselves from other metal acts with their flawless fusion of technicality, melody, and ferocity in their music.

Kadinja's dynamic compositions exhibit a specific emotive character in their music. Every song they write transports the listener on a journey through beautiful and harsh landscapes. It is interesting how they can combine many styles of metal, like djent and progressive metal, without altering their distinctive sound.

What are the most popular songs for Progressive Metal musician kadinja?

Paris-based Progressive Metal band Kadinja has gained recognition for its distinctive sound and appearance. Fans of the genre have paid the band a lot of attention thanks to a number of their well-known songs. They have a number of songs that are very well-liked, including "Stone of Mourning," "Glhf," "The Modern Rage," "A November Day," "Empire," "'Til the Ground Disappears," "Episteme," "From the Inside," "Dominique," and "Ropes of You."

With its sophisticated guitar riffs and strong vocals, "Stone of Mourning" is a piece that perfectly captures Kadinja's sound. The track's intricate time signatures and dramatic changes give it a distinctly progressive flavor. With its powerful chords and sophisticated drumming, "Glhf" is another song that displays Kadinja's technical talent. The song has a more lively vibe to it and has a chorus that will stick in your brain.

The song "The Modern Rage" combines metalcore and djent with Kadinja's progressive style. Along with powerful breakdowns and chugging riffs, the song also has shrill screams and soaring clean vocals. A more melodious song, "A November Day" features crisp guitar tones and ethereal synthesizers. The song contains an emotive chorus, melancholy lyrics, and a mesmerizing beat.

Which are the most important music performances and festival appearances for Progressive Metal musician kadinja?

The French progressive metal band Kadinja has made some notable appearances at different music events and venues. One of their most notable performances took place at Euroblast, the premier progressive and technical metal festival in Europe. Their lively and fascinating set made their 2019 visit at Euroblast stand out in particular.

Kadinja had another major festival debut in 2018 at the Radar Festival, where they displayed their technical mastery and musical talent. The audience enjoyed the band's performance at Submit Fest in 2019, when they were treated to a lively and interesting set.

A number of the best venues in Europe, including Doornroosje in Nijmegen, the Netherlands, Bi Nuu in Berlin, Germany, and Poglos in Warsaw, Poland, have hosted performances by Kadinja. Their energetic stage presence and excellent technical prowess have won plaudits for their performances at various venues.

Kadinja has also performed at the READY for PROG Festival in Toulouse, France, and the Nantes Metal Fest in Nantes, France, in addition to these appearances.
